Dear M. Ball
Thank you for your email received by Transport for London (TfL) on 20
April 2011 asking for a copy of all correspondence between TfL and NATS on
15, 16, 17, and 18 March 2011 regarding the Cable Car.
Your request has been considered under the requirements of the
Environmental Information Regulations 2004 and I can confirm that TfL does
hold the information you require. You asked for:
A copy of all correspondence between TFL and NATS on 15TH , 16TH , 17TH ,
AND 18TH March 2011 regarding the Cable Car.
A copy of this is attached. Some of the information you have requested has
been redacted from the attached email exchange as TfL is not obliged to
supply it, because it is subject to a statutory exception to the right of
access to information, under Regulation 12(5)(e) of the EIRs - `the
confidentiality of commercial or industrial information where such
confidentiality is provided by law to protect a legitimate economic
interest' and under Regulation 13 -`personal data'.
TfL is applying Regulation 12(5)(e) because disclosure of the financial
details which have been redacted would adversely affect TfL and NATS'
legitimate economic interests by revealing the daily rate which NATS
charged for providing the service described in the email exchange. This
would compromise their ability to compete for the provision for similar
services in the future and adversely affect TfL's ability to gain the best
possible value from suppliers of such services. This information is held
by TfL under a common law duty of confidence.
The use of this exception is subject to an assessment of the public
interest in relation to the disclosure of the information concerned. There
is a general public interest in the disclosure of information held by
public authorities, to promote transparency and accountability, but in
this instance this is outweighed by the public interest in preserving the
ability of NATS to compete effectively and, particularly, the ability to
ensure TfL gains the best possible value from suppliers of services.
Regulation 13 has been applied to redact the contact details of
individuals, as disclosure would contravene the first principle of the
Data Protection Act 1998, which requires all processing of personal data
to be `fair and lawful'. In this case disclosure would be `unfair' as the
individuals concerned have a legitimate expectation that their contact
details will not be made public.
